ABSTRACT
Nutritional problems like PEM, anaemia and vitamin A deficiency continue to plague a
large proportion of Indian children. Moringa oleifera flower contains adequate amount of
calcium, iron, vitamin C and fiber for the women, children and old age people. Moringa oleifera
is widely used in India, since the Ayurveda and Yunani medicinal systems, use it for the
treatment of several ailments. The flowers have many therapeutic values for human beings. But it
was less utilized by the people. Hence, the present study was undertaken to use the M. oleifera
flowers for the development food products. The M. oleifera flowers powder was prepared by
dehydration method and the food products such as vermicelli, chappathi and idli powder were
prepared by the incorporation of M. oleifera flowers powder at various concentrations (5%, 10%
and 15 %). The sensory evaluation results revealed that, 15 % of M. oleifera flowers powder
incorporated Idly powder, 10 % incorporated Chappathi and 5 % incorporated Vermicelli were
accepted by most of the people. The nutrient content of100 gm of Moringa oleifera flower
powder was analysed and was reported as 3.2% of ash, 5.18% of moisture, 12 g of protein, 3%
of fiber, 44.8 mg of vitamin C, 48 mg of calcium, 11 mg of iron, 32 mg of phosphorus and 160
μg of β carotene. The biochemical analysis of Moringa oleifera flower incorporated idli powder
was carried out and it was reported as 5% of ash, 9.20% of moisture, 42 g of protein, 3.50 of
fiber, 24 mg of calcium, 46 mg . Moringa oleifera flower powder incorporated products were
stored upto 30 days without undergoing any deteriorative change under both room and
refrigeration condition. The present findings provide a new strategy to utilize the M. oleifera
flower powder as nutritional as well as functional ingredient for eradicating many of the
diseases.
